Results for : layla price

STANDARD - 23,197   GOLD - 4,622

Hardcore Layla red

Damn Layla b.

Layla Evee Finger Herself

Layla gets it in

Layla Red (One Night Only)

BBC strokes redbone deep

Layla London

Layla love